Airworthiness Directives (ADs)

CAA-2012-03-006

The aircraft owner or operator shall comply with Airworthiness Directives issued by the CAA or the aeronautics authority of the State of Design (SoD) of the aviation products, appliances and parts, and take all necessary actions thereto.

Issue Date
2012/03/15
Applicability
The Boeing Company Model 747-100,747-100B,747-100B SUD,747-200B,747-200C,747-200F,747-300,747-400,747-400D,747-400F,747SP,and 747SR series airplanes; certificated in any category; as identified in Boeing Service Bulletin 747-53A2563, Revision 4, dated May 6, 2010.
Model Number
The Boeing Company Model 747-100,747-100B,747-100B SUD,747-200B,747-200C,747-200F,747-300,747-400,747-400D,747-400F,747SP,and 747SR.
CAA AD Number
CAA-2012-03-006
Aeronautics Authority of Original AD
FAA
Original AD Number
2012-04-09
Effective Date
2012/04/10
Subject
We are issuing this AD to detect and correct scribe lines, which can develop into fatigue cracks in the skin and cause sudden decompression of the airplane.
Reference Publications (Revision/ATA/SB)
Boeing Service Bulletin 747-53A2563, Revision 4, dated May 6, 2010
